Manchester City vs Brentford – Man City to Win & BTTS: No

City are clear favourites in this one. Brentford are a decent side but are much better at home and Pep Guardiola’s men should have enough to settle this in 90 minutes.

Looking at Kickform’s stats across the season, both teams have scored in 63% of Brentford’s Premier League matches, the third highest in the league. However, the Bees have failed to score in away defeats to Crystal Palace, Arsenal, and Tottenham in recent weeks, in a run of four consecutive away losses.

After shipping a few goals of late City have tightened up with 3-0 wins over Sunderland at home and Palace away, with a 2-1 away win over Real Madrid in the Champions League sandwiched in between. We think Wednesday will see City get another clean sheet along with a sixth successive win in all competitions.

Manchester City vs Brentford: Phil Foden Anytime Goalscorer

Phil Foden is in great form in front of goal this season. The England international has 10 goals in 21 matches in all competitions, including six in the last five matches. He has scored once in two Carabao Cup appearances, and we back him to get on the sheet again.

Newcastle United vs Fulham: Over 9.5 Corners

It has been a frustrating season for Carabao Cup holders Newcastle United. The Magpies may have made a decent start to defending the trophy with wins over Bradford City and Tottenham Hotspur, but they sit in mid-table in the Premier League, four points adrift of the European places.

Fulham have seen off Bristol City, Cambridge United and Wycombe Wanderers to reach this stage. The Cottagers have won their last two away games in the league and were possibly unfortunate not to take a point at St James’ Park when the two sides met in October.

One league table Newcastle top is for corners won, with an average of 6.13 per game in the Premier League. Fulham have won an average of 5.13 per game. 56% of Newcastle’s league matches and 69% of Fulham’s league matches have produced 10 or more corners. All of Fulham’s Carabao Cup games have seen the corner count hit double figures. So, in a cup tie between two sides lacking in consistency, we think that this is the market to go with.
